This procurement is being issued as a 100% SMALL BUSINESS set-aside under NAICS code 212321and small business size standard of 500 employees The requirement: One line item: 3240 c. y of crushed aggregate for road surfacing which meet Standard Specifications for Construction of Roads and Bridges of Federal Highway Projects (FP-03 section 703.05(c)) which are attached. The gravel shall meet the gradiaion in Table 703-3 TARGET VALUE RANGES for SURFACE COARSE GRADIATION & PLASTICITY INDEX. Quote shall include unit pricing and extended total for the line item. Government will pick up material at Contractor’s pit. Contractor shall provide all material and effort/cost to crush material to specifications, and the machinery to load material into Government truck. Please contact Rich Raines @406-363-7178 for technical information and Tina Mainey @ 406-329-3845 for contractual information. The gravel is needed by May 1, 2009 for surfacing of Burnt Fork Road east of Stevensville, Montana. Exact dates and timing for loading trucks at Vendor’s pit will be negotiated, based on overall project progress. One award will be made.
